KKWEZVA 20pcs natural finely spotted mallard flank feathers hand selected teal duck feathers wings&tails fly tying material

KKWEZVA 20pcs natural finely spotted mallard flank feathers hand selected teal duck feathers wings&tails fly tying material
thumb
thumb
thumb
thumb
thumb
sku: 1005002283885060
$5.50
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ed